Transaction 66f28916df43f56b620ddc862a04566e4b883df9756ca2497a2fe1c4e6c1b546
1 Input
2 Outputs
- 66f28916df43f56b620ddc862a04566e4b883df9756ca2497a2fe1c4e6c1b546:0
- 66f28916df43f56b620ddc862a04566e4b883df9756ca2497a2fe1c4e6c1b546:1
value 94352
address 1FJdZcPXvFjgLMDQysZx5mUq1YcuHU6bAU
value 43887902
address 1BaeA5r3AgtVsiGW6PJrEnNL4hfQiWdJrG